• jsp include page指令标记


    include指令标记

    <jsp:include page="">
    父页面和包含进来的页面单独编译,单独翻译成servlet后,在前台拼成一个HTML页面。

    动态编译
    <% @include file="" %>
    父页面和包含进来的页面,代码合并后,才一起翻译成servlet,反馈到前台,形成一个HTML页面。

    静态编译

    注意:合并后的Jsp页面必须保证符合JSP语法规则。

    page指令标记

    1.language属性(不用设置)

    目前只可以用Java语言编译jsp网页 <% @page language="java"%>

    默认language属性值为 language-"java"

    2.import属性

    引入java API 多个API之间加逗号 <% @page import="java.sql.*" %>

    默认import属性已经有如下的值:"java.lang.*"、"java.servlet.*"、"javax.servlet.jsp.*"、"javax.servlet.http.*"

    3.contentType属性

    确定JSP页面响应的MIME(Multipurpose Internet Mail Extension)类型和JSP页面字符的编码

    默认contentType属性值text/html;charset=ISO-8859-1

    4.session属性(不用设置)

    设置是否需要使用内置的session对象,可以true或false

    默认是true

    5.buffer属性(不用设置)

    内置输出流对象out负责将服务器的某些信息或运行结果发动到用户端显示,buffer属性用来指定out设置的缓冲区的大小或不使用缓冲区,none表示不使用缓冲区

    默认是8kb

    6.autoFlush属性(不用设置)

    true或false,指定out的缓冲区被填满时,缓冲区是否自动刷新,值为false时,如果out的缓冲区被填满,就会出现缓存溢出异常

    默认是true

    7.isThreadSafe属性(不用设置)

    true或false,设置JSP页面是否可以多线程访问

    默认是true

    8.info属性(不用设置)

    是一个字符串,为JSP页面准备一个常用且可能需要经常修改的字符串

    taglib指令标记

    使用标签库定义新的自定义标签,在JSP页面中启用定制行为

    语法:<%@ taglib uri="URIToTagLibrary" prefix="tagPrefix" %>

    例子:<%@ taglib uri="http://www.jspcentral.com/tags" prefix="JAXP" %>

  • 相关阅读:
    [HNOI 2009] 有趣的数列
    [HAOI2015] 树上染色
    [BZOJ 2654] tree
    【图论 搜索】bzoj1064: [Noi2008]假面舞会
    【倍增】7.11fusion
    【二分 贪心】bzoj3477: [Usaco2014 Mar]Sabotage
    【计数】7.11跳棋
    概述「贪心“反悔”策略」模型
    复习计划里的低级错误
    【模拟】bzoj1686: [Usaco2005 Open]Waves 波纹
  • 原文地址:https://www.cnblogs.com/yaochc/p/3485239.html
Copyright © 2020-2023  润新知